Methods and Practices of Zoning and Grading for Groundwater Pollution Control in Industrial Parks
There are a large number of industrial parks in China,covering a wide range of industries such as pharmaceuticals,electronics,chemicals and metal manufacturing,which bring better economic benefits while also posing greater environmental risks.Because industrial parks cover large areas and have different pollution conditions,a one-size-fits-all approach may result in excessive remediation or ineffective control.In this regard,based on the severity of pollution in each area of the park,the size of the risk to the surrounding environmental elements,the urgency of the control needs and other factors,put forward a groundwater pollution control zoning grading method,and in a stainless steel industrial park in Zhejiang(the park is divided into two priority control areas,eight key control areas)to carry out the practical application of the risk of groundwater contamination for the follow-up control work has laid a certain foundation.The method was practically applied in a stainless steel industrial park in Zhejiang,the park is divided into 2 priority control areas and 8 key control areas,laying a certain foundation for the follow-up control of groundwater pollution risk.
